Salter launches national shooting week
The first-ever National Shooting Week will be launched on Monday at the National Shooting Centre at Bisley, known as ‘the home of shooting’. From Saturday May 26th to Sunday June 3rd, thousands of people across the UK will try one of the most exciting Olympic sports during National Shooting Week.

Shooting schools and clubs are putting on more than 200 open days across the country so the public can try shooting for the first time.

Martin Salter will be speaking at the launch event and pressing for the Home Office to approve the protocol which would allow British Target Pistol shooters the ability to practice in the U.K in order to prepare for the 2012 Olympic Games.

Currently, target pistols are restricted under the legislation governing handguns although an exemption can be applied for organised events.

Reading West MP and Labour’s Spokesperson for shooting sports, Martin Salter MP said:

“I fully support the ideals behind National Shooting Week, particularly with the 2012 Olympic and Paralympic Games in mind. The event will also demystify certain imagery surrounding guns and give members of the public a great day out in a safe environment.

"I will continue my efforts to end the absurdity of British shooters having to travel abroad to practice their sport. This is particularly daft when exemptions already exist in legislation and shooting is one of the few sports that delivers a substantial clutch of medals for Britain.”

Lord Shrewsbury, chairman of event organiser, the British Shooting Sports Council, said:

“At the 2006 Commonwealth Games in Melbourne, shooting accounted for 23 out of the UK’s 116 medals, so the sport will have a huge role to play in the 2012 Olympic Games. National Shooting Week is all about people experiencing a popular sport that Britain is actually good at!”

A group of the UK’s finest Olympic, Paralympic, Commonwealth and international medal winning shooters will be on hand at Bisley to lend their support to National Shooting Week. Olympic gold medallist Richard Faulds, who will be giving a shooting demonstration, said:

“I’m delighted to support National Shooting Week because initiatives to raise awareness of shooting sports in the public eye on a grand scale can only be a good thing.”
